Overview
  • Patient Registrar, Registration, Pool/PRN/As needed
  • Location: Mercyhealth Janesville
  • Schedule: Varied

Mercyhealth Patient Registrars are responsible for patient registration duties at Mercyhealth Hospital locations. They greet patients and family members, assist with questions, and ensure accurate registration in the electronic medical record. This role requires confidence with technology and typing, but no prior healthcare experience is necessary. Shifts may include Emergency Department settings, requiring readiness to see serious injuries and illnesses. The position involves weekend and holiday rotations.

Responsibilities
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
  • Engage positively with patients, visitors, and staff, demonstrating friendliness and professionalism.
  • Participate in team activities, quality improvement, and training.
  • Provide shadowing and training to new team members.
  • Handle highly emotional and demanding situations with good judgment.
  • Assist with patient check-in, triage, and emergency assessments.
  • Verify patient identity, insurance, and demographic information accurately.
  • Collect payments, co-pays, and pre-payments as applicable.
  • Coordinate patient movement and provide updates to patients and staff.
  • Support hospital operations during downtime or emergencies.
  • Maintain confidentiality and adhere to healthcare regulations.
  • Perform light cleaning and ensure a welcoming environment.
  • Complete educational requirements and other duties as assigned.
Education and Experience
  • High school diploma or equivalent preferred.
  • 1-2 years of customer service experience required.
  • Knowledge of third-party payors and medical terminology is a plus.
Skills and Abilities
  • Self-motivated with a positive attitude and sense of urgency.
  • Proficient in computer navigation, typing, and data entry.
  • Strong communication, problem-solving, and conflict management sk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
Physical Demands

Medium work exerting 10-25 lbs. frequently and 25-60 lbs. occasionally. Requires sitting, standing, walking, reaching, and manual dexterity. Vision and hearing abilities include close, color, and distance vision, and the ability to operate equipment.

Benefits
  • Comprehensive medical, dental, vision, retirement, and wellness programs.
  • Paid time off, career development, and employee assistance resources.
Additional Details
  • Entry level, full-time position in healthcare.
  • May require working alternate shifts, weekends, and overtime.
